水下个人语音通信系统发射机研制
evelopment of Underwater Personal Speech Communication System's Transmitter
本文设计了一种用于水下个人语音通信系统的新型发射机。该发射机具有效率高、抗干扰能力强、小型化的优点。发射机由光电耦合电路、D类功率放大器、变压器、匹配电路及发射换能器组成。设计并实现了消声水池试验,实验结果证明了系统的可行性,符合相应的设计要求。
In this paper, a new type of transmitter circuit for underwater voice communication system based on analysis of its working principle is presented. The transmitter has the outstanding advantages of high efficiency, strong anti-jamming capability, and miniaturization. The transmitter circuit consists of photoelectric coupled circuit transmission system, class-D audio power amplifier, the matching circuits and transducer. The experimental study has been made in the anechoic tank. Test results show that the circuit design is correct, the components are matching reasonably. The design has superior performance and has achieved the system requirements.
